Subject: Friendly Reminder: Please Return the Borrowed Item Dear [Recipient's Name], I hope this letter finds you well. I am writing to gently remind you about a borrowed item that is currently in your possession. It would be greatly appreciated if you could kindly return it to its rightful owner as soon as possible. The borrowed item in question is [provide a detailed description of the item, including its make, model, color, brand, or any other specific identifiers]. The item was borrowed from [mention the institution, organization, or individual it originally belongs to] on [mention the date it was borrowed]. We understand that sometimes lending or borrowing items can result in minor oversights or forgetfulness. However, it is important to emphasize that the prompt return of the borrowed item is highly necessary, as it may be needed by others or may hold significant value to its owner. Could you please ensure that the item is returned by [mention a specific deadline, if applicable]? If, for any reason, you are unable to meet this deadline, kindly inform us about the delay as soon as possible, allowing us to make alternative arrangements if necessary. We kindly ask you to take a few moments to search for the item and return it to [provide the return address or any other preferred method of return] by [mention a specific date or time]. We understand that life can get busy, so we greatly appreciate your cooperation in this matter. Please note that failure to return the borrowed item within a reasonable timeframe may result in the need for further action, which may include charging for the replacement or pursuing legal action. We sincerely hope it doesn't come to that, and we believe that we can resolve this matter amicably. If you have any questions or concerns regarding the borrowed item or need any assistance with its return, please do not hesitate to contact us at [provide contact information]. Thank you very much for your attention to this matter. We appreciate your cooperation and look forward to the timely return of the borrowed item. If a person is unable to enter a residence or former residence to retrieve property belonging to the person or the person's dependent because the current occupant is denying the person entry, the person may apply to the Justice Court for an order authorizing the person to enter the residence, accompanied by a peace

The demand should include proof or describe the reason why the personal property is not under the ownership of the person of the current person or entity in possession. There should also be dates when the property must be returned to its rightful owner or else legal action or small claims court filings will begin.
